This video demonstrates how to effectively organize an AR-15 rifle, magazines, and accessories within a hard-shell case using the Magpul DAKA Grid Organizer system. The process involves removing old foam, installing the modular grid panels, and snapping gear into place for a secure and tidy setup. This method offers a superior alternative to traditional foam cutouts for protecting and accessing firearm components.

Quick Summary

The Magpul DAKA Grid Organizer provides a modular, peg-style layout for securely storing firearms, magazines, and accessories in hard cases. It replaces traditional foam, offering better organization and protection by allowing gear to be snapped firmly into place.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the Magpul DAKA Grid Organizer?

The Magpul DAKA Grid Organizer is a modular system that uses a peg-style grid and customizable blocks to securely hold firearms, magazines, and accessories within hard-shell cases, offering a more organized and protected storage solution than traditional foam.

How do you install the Magpul DAKA Grid Organizer?

Installation involves removing old foam from your rifle case, placing the DAKA Grid panels into the case, and then snapping your gear, such as an AR-15 rifle and PMAGs, into the grid using the provided blocks.

What are the benefits of using the DAKA Grid Organizer over foam?

The DAKA Grid offers superior organization, security, and adaptability. Unlike foam, which is permanently cut, the grid allows for easy rearrangement and ensures gear stays firmly in place, preventing shifting and damage during transport.
